Information Schema
许多 INFORMATION_SCHEMA
表都有相应的 SHOW
命令。查询 INFORMATION_SCHEMA
的好处是可以在表之间进行 join
操作。
TiDB 中的扩展表
表名 | 描述 |
---|---|
ANALYZE_STATUS | 提供有关收集统计信息的任务的信息。 |
汇总由客户端请求生成并返回给客户端的错误和警告。 | |
CLIENT_ERRORS_SUMMARY_BY_USER | 汇总由客户端产生的错误和警告。 |
汇总由客户端产生的错误和警告。 | |
CLUSTER_CONFIG | 提供有关整个 TiDB 集群的配置设置的详细信息。 |
CLUSTER_DEADLOCKS | 提供 DEADLOCKS 表的集群级别的视图。 |
提供在每个 TiDB 组件上发现的底层物理硬件的详细信息。 | |
CLUSTER_INFO | 提供当前集群拓扑的详细信息。 |
提供集群中 TiDB 服务器的当前负载信息。 | |
CLUSTER_LOG | 提供整个 TiDB 集群的日志。 |
CLUSTER_MEMORY_USAGE | 提供 MEMORY_USAGE 表的集群级别的视图。 |
提供 MEMORY_USAGE_OPS_HISTORY 表的集群级别的视图。 | |
CLUSTER_PROCESSLIST | 提供 PROCESSLIST 表的集群级别的视图。 |
CLUSTER_SLOW_QUERY | 提供 SLOW_QUERY 表的集群级别的视图。 |
CLUSTER_STATEMENTS_SUMMARY | 提供 STATEMENTS_SUMMARY 表的集群级别的视图。 |
CLUSTER_STATEMENTS_SUMMARY_HISTORY | 提供 STATEMENTS_SUMMARY_HISTORY 表的集群级别的视图。 |
CLUSTER_TIDB_TRX | 提供 TIDB_TRX 表的集群级别的视图。 |
提供集群中服务器的内核参数配置的详细信息。 | |
DATA_LOCK_WAITS | 提供 TiKV 服务器上的等锁信息。 |
提供与 ADMIN SHOW DDL JOBS 类似的输出。 | |
DEADLOCKS | 提供 TiDB 节点上最近发生的数次死锁错误的信息。 |
触发内部诊断检查。 | |
INSPECTION_RULES | 进行的内部诊断检查的列表。 |
重要监视指标的摘要报告。 | |
MEMORY_USAGE | 提供当前 TiDB 实例的内存使用情况。 |
提供当前 TiDB 实例内存相关的历史操作和执行依据。 | |
METRICS_SUMMARY | 从 Prometheus 获取的指标的摘要。 |
METRICS_SUMMARY_BY_LABEL | 参见 METRICS_SUMMARY 表。 |
为 METRICS_SCHEMA 中的表提供 PromQL 定义。 | |
PLACEMENT_POLICIES | 提供所有放置策略的定义信息。 |
描述了基于 MariaDB 实现的 TiDB 序列。 | |
SLOW_QUERY | 提供当前 TiDB 服务器上慢查询的信息。 |
类似于 MySQL 中的 performance_schema 语句摘要。 | |
STATEMENTS_SUMMARY_HISTORY | 类似于 MySQL 中的 performance_schema 语句摘要历史。 |
提供存储的表的大小的详细信息。 | |
TIDB_HOT_REGIONS | 提供有关哪些 Region 访问次数最多的统计信息。 |
提供有关哪些 Region 访问次数最多的历史统计信息。 | |
TIDB_INDEXES | 提供有关 TiDB 表的索引信息。 |
提供 TiDB 服务器的列表 | |
TIDB_TRX | 提供 TiDB 节点上正在执行的事务的信息。 |
提供有关 TiFlash 副本的详细信息。 | |
TIKV_REGION_PEERS | 提供 Region 存储位置的详细信息。 |
提供 Region 的统计信息。 | |
TIKV_STORE_STATUS | 提供 TiKV 服务器的基本信息。 |